Priscilla Block is a country-pop artist who found success in 2020 with a string of relatable singles ("PMS," "Thick Thighs," and "Just About Over You,") that effectively paired earworm melodies with unfiltered lyrics. She followed up on that success in early 2021 with the single "I Bet You Wanna Know," which appeared on her eponymous debut EP later that year.
A native of Raleigh, North Carolina, Block moved to Nashville after graduating high school to pursue a career in music. After enduring a litany of odd jobs to make ends meet, she had a surprise encounter with Taylor Swift -- her longtime idol -- which gave her the morale boost she needed to go all in on her musical dreams. In 2020 she began uploading a steady stream of self-penned songs and choice covers to her social media channel and quickly began accumulating a fervent fan base, who connected with the themes of empowerment, self-love, and acceptance that imbued her original works like "Thick Thighs" and "PMS." Those fans helped Block raise enough money to release a proper single, and the resulting "Just About Over You" became a hit, topping the streaming charts and earning Block a record deal with Block Mercury Nashville/InDent Records. She released her eponymous debut EP the following year, which included the anthemic single "I Bet You Wanna Know." ~ James Christopher Monger
